Economic signals like inflation and fluctuating demand have heightened sensitivity around transportation costs. Travelers increasingly report that pre-booking rental cars often leads to denied inventory, inflated pricing, or vehicles that don’t match their needs—especially in high-demand cities or periods around holidays. Meanwhile, rental companies face staffing challenges due to tight labor markets, affecting responsiveness and service quality. In a time when UAW labor delays, rising fuel costs, and unpredictable availability grip the rental market, a quiet wave of discussion has grown across US social feeds and travel forums. For many, the experience starts before stepping into a car: long wait times at desks, mismatched vehicle choices, and confusing insurance policies create growing irritation.
